海纳百川 (@zmone)[免费TTS]文字转语音,支持各种角色发音,-适配openai格式 中发帖

在环境变量中添加 FISHKEY,值为您的多个 Fish Audio API 密钥,用英文逗号分隔。例如: 
key1,key2,key3



在环境变量中添加 TTSKEY,值为您想要用于认证的密钥。【这个是你设置的key】


下面代码实现效果:


将https://api.fish.audio/v1/tts的API进行了openai格式适配


input参数是fish接口的text


voice参数是fish接口的reference_id【声音角色】

这个id参考https://fish.audio官方API



model没啥用,是一个假参数,随便传了就行
效果:兼容openai格式
curl https://你的域名
-H “Authorization: Bearer 123”
-H “Content-Type: application/js...